# RecDP v2.0

# INTRODUCTION

## Problem Statement

Data Preparation is an essential step to build AI pipelines 
* key data preparation capabilities: data connector, cleaning, sampling, joining, profiling, feature engineering, low-code/no-code UI, lineage etc. 
* exploration of optimal Data preparation consumes majority of Data Science time

## Solution with RecDP v2.0

* Auto pipeline
    * only 3 lines of codes required
* Pipeline Generator
    * Data Profiling:
        * Auto anomalies detection
        * Auto missing value impute
        * Profiling Visualizzation        
    * Feature Wrangling:
        * feature transformation(datetime, geo_info, text_nlp, url, etc.)
        * multiple data auto joining
        * feature cross(aggregation transformation - sum, avg, count, etc.)
    * export pipeline as JSON file, can be import to other data platform
* Pipeline Runner:
    * spark engine: convert pipeline to spark codes to run
    * pandas engine: convert pipeline to pandas codes to run
    * sql engine: convert pipeline to sql
* DataLoader:
    * parquet, csv, json, database
* FeatureWriter - ML/DL connector:
    * Data Lineage
    * Feature Store
    * numpy, csv, parquet, dgl / pyG graph

## modify pipeline (add user defined function or remove operation)
``` python
def filter_with_cond(df):
    df = df[df['Year'] <= 2018]
    return df
operation = {
    "children": [6], # will to append this new op
    "next": [7], # who will be connected to this new op
    "inline_function": filter_with_cond, # function
}
pipeline.add_operation(operation)
```
``` python
operation = {
    "idx": 6, # OP id to be deleted
    "next": [10] # who is connected to the to_be_deleted op
}
pipeline.delete_operation(operation)
```

## export pipeline
``` python
pipeline.export(file_path = "exported_pipeline.json")
```
